What strategies can cryptocurrency traders use to prepare for the bitcoin halving timer?
What are some effective strategies that cryptocurrency traders can employ to prepare for the upcoming bitcoin halving event?

- Sarissa FarmanApr 22, 2024 · 2 years agoAs a cryptocurrency trader, there are several strategies you can use to prepare for the bitcoin halving timer. Firstly, it's important to stay informed about the halving event and its potential impact on the market. Keep an eye on news, forums, and social media platforms to gather insights from experts and fellow traders. Additionally, consider diversifying your portfolio to minimize risk. Allocate your investments across different cryptocurrencies and even traditional assets. This can help mitigate any potential losses caused by market volatility during the halving period. Lastly, have a clear plan in place. Define your investment goals, set stop-loss orders, and stick to your strategy. By being proactive and well-prepared, you can navigate the bitcoin halving event with confidence.

One strategy you can use to prepare for this epic event is to analyze historical data. Take a look at previous halvings and see how the market reacted. This can give you valuable insights into potential price movements and trends. Another tip is to keep an eye on the overall market sentiment. If there's a lot of hype and excitement building up, it might be a good idea to take some profits off the table before the halving. And don't forget about risk management! Set stop-loss orders and stick to them. This will help protect your hard-earned gains in case things go south. So, gear up, traders, and get ready to ride the halving wave!

- Cooper HammerFeb 25, 2026 · 5 months agoPreparing for the bitcoin halving timer requires a combination of research, risk management, and strategic thinking. Start by studying the historical patterns of previous halvings. Look at how the market reacted before and after the event. This can give you insights into potential price movements and help you make informed decisions. Additionally, consider diversifying your portfolio. Don't put all your eggs in one basket. Allocate your investments across different cryptocurrencies and even traditional assets. This can help minimize risk and protect your capital. Lastly, stay updated on the latest news and developments in the cryptocurrency space. By being well-informed, you can adapt your strategies accordingly and make the most of the bitcoin halving event.
